Olaplex (NASDAQ:OLPX – Get Free Report) will likely be announcing its Q2 2026 results before the market opens on Thursday, August 6th. Analysts expect Olaplex to announce earnings of $0.02 per share and revenue of $107.12 million for the quarter. Parties can find conference call details on the company’s upcoming Q2 2026 earning report page for the latest details on the call scheduled for Thursday, August 6, 2026 at 9:00 AM ET.
Olaplex (NASDAQ:OLPX –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Monday, May 11th. The company reported $0.02 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.01 by $0.01. Olaplex had a positive return on equity of 2.23% and a negative net margin of 3.53%.The business had revenue of $99.37 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$94.11 million.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 2.5%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, analysts expect Olaplex to post $0 EPS for the current fiscal year and $0 EPS for the next fiscal year.

Olaplex Company Profile
Olaplex, Inc (NASDAQ: OLPX) is a specialty haircare company known for its patented bond-building technology designed to repair and strengthen hair from within. The company’s core offerings encompass a range of professional salon treatments and at-home maintenance products that target chemical damage, breakage and split ends. Olaplex formulations are built around a proprietary active ingredient that works at the molecular level to rebuild disulfide bonds broken during bleaching, coloring and heat styling processes.
Founded in 2014 and headquartered in Irvine, California, Olaplex initially gained traction among high-end salons before expanding into broader retail channels.
